🔍 Know the signs. Get the right support sooner.

If your loved one or patient is experiencing any of these, it may be time to talk about palliative or hospice care:
1️⃣ Increasing falls
2️⃣ More help needed for everyday tasks
3️⃣ Unexplained weight loss
4️⃣ Repeated ER visits or hospital stays
5️⃣ Health declining despite treatment
6️⃣ Symptoms that are hard to manage

Palliative care can start early alongside any treatment to improve comfort and quality of life. Hospice is there when comfort becomes the priority.

Grief touches us in many ways—emotionally, physically, and spiritually.

With Arbor Hospice’s Grief Journey program, you can access guidance, community, and practical tools to help you move through loss.

Reactions may include crying, withdrawal, restlessness, changes in appetite, or shifts in faith. These responses aren’t a timeline—give yourself permission to grieve, rest, and seek support. If you’re supporting someone, offer a listening presence.

We're excited to announce that registration is open for Camp Good Grief 2026!

Camp Good Grief is a free, day-long camp for kids ages 8–17 who have experienced the death of someone close to them.

This special program gives kids a supportive space to express their feelings, learn about the grief process, and connect with others who understand what they’re going through. And just as important — the day is filled with FUN.

Held outdoors among beautiful fields and forests, Camp Good Grief blends adventure and healing with activities like zip-lining, kayaking, art, and music, along with guided conversations and emotional support.

Each camp includes:
✨ Master’s-level grief support counselors
✨ Board-Certified Music Therapists
✨ Hospice-trained volunteers
✨ Pet volunteers and their comforting companions
